Notes:
1. Typical data are based on TA=25°C, VDD=5V (4.5V≤VDD≤6.0V range) and VDD=3.3V (3V≤VDD≤3.6V range).
2. Data based on characterization results, tested in production at VDD max. and fOSC max.
3. CPU running with memory access, all I/O pins in input with pull-up mode (no load), all peripherals in reset state; clock
input (OSCIN) driven by external square wave, OSG and LVD disabled, option bytes not programmed.
